Getting Started: Registration & Verification
Signing up at an online Australian casino typically takes five to ten minutes, but the exact steps can vary. You’ll be asked for basic personal details – name, date of birth, residential address and a contact email. Australian operators are required to verify identity to meet AML (Anti‑Money‑Laundering) regulations, so be prepared to upload a scanned passport or driver’s licence and a recent utility bill.
Most sites streamline this KYC (Know Your Customer) process with an in‑app upload feature that instantly checks the documents against a database. If verification fails on the first try, double‑check that the images are clear and the details match your account information. A quick tip: keep a digital copy of your ID handy before you start – it saves you a frantic hunt later on.
Choosing the Right Bonus – Welcome Offers & Wagering Requirements
Bonuses are the biggest lure for Aussie players, but they come with fine‑print that can bite if you’re not careful. The most common offering is a welcome bonus that matches your first deposit – for example, 100% up to AU$500. Look beyond the headline amount and focus on the wagering requirement, expressed as a multiple of the bonus (e.g., 30×). A 30× requirement on a $500 bonus means you need to wager $15,000 before you can cash out.
Some operators sweeten the deal with free spins on popular slots, but those often have separate wagering caps. When comparing offers, calculate the “effective value” by dividing the bonus amount by the wagering multiple; a lower number means a more player‑friendly deal. Remember, a huge bonus with a 60× requirement is usually less attractive than a modest 20× offer.
Payment Methods – Deposits, Withdrawals & Speed
Australian players enjoy a wide range of payment options, from traditional credit cards to modern e‑wallets. The most popular deposit methods are Visa, Mastercard, POLi, and PayID, each typically processing instantly so you can start playing right away. When it comes to withdrawals, the speed can vary dramatically – e‑wallets often pay out within 24 hours, whereas bank transfers may take 3‑5 business days.
Below is a quick reference of common payment methods and their typical processing times:
- PayPal / Skrill / Neteller – instant deposits, 24‑48 h withdrawals
- POLi / PayID – instant deposits, 1‑2 business days withdrawals
- Visa / Mastercard – instant deposits, 2‑4 business days withdrawals
- Bank Transfer – instant deposits (if supported), 3‑5 business days withdrawals
